Two dominant backs in Josh Kibel and Tj Eurich are getting ready to go toe-to-toe. The Dove Creek Bulldogs are taking a road trip to take on the Simla Cubs at 1:00 p.m. on Sunday. Dove Creek is strutting in with some offensive muscle as they've averaged 41.2 points per game this season.
Dove Creek is coming in fresh off a high-stakes matchup with another one of Colorado's top teams: Sanford, who was ranked 14th in their home state at the time (Dove Creek was ranked 15th). Dove Creek lost 41-18 to Sanford last Friday. The Bulldogs' loss signaled the end of their three-game winning streak.
Although Dove Creek took the loss, they still got scores from Trevan Ivie, Nicholas Aragon, and Kibel.
Meanwhile, Simla entered their tilt with South Park on Saturday with two consecutive wins but they'll enter their next game with three. They had just enough and edged the Burros out 2-0. The two-point effort marked the Cubs' lowest-scoring match of the season, but in the end it didn't matter.
Simla is on a roll lately: they've won five of their last six contests, which provided a nice bump to their 7-2 record this season. Those victories were due in large part to their defensive effort, having only surrendered 12.7 points per game. As for Dove Creek, their defeat ended a six-game streak of wins at home dating back to last season and dropped them to 7-2.
Dove Creek didn't have too much breathing room in their game against Simla in their previous matchup back in November of 2022, but they still walked away with a 26-21 win. The rematch might be a little tougher for Dove Creek since the squad won't have the home-field advantage this time around. We'll see if the change in venue makes a difference.
